ongoingThe 70s: Transmigrating as the Jilted Supporting Character
After living for ten years, Shui Dao realized she was a supporting character in a transmigration novel set in the 1970s. The original female lead was an intelligent, charming young woman working in the countryside, who captivated many bachelors in the Willow Production Team, including Shui Dao's childhood fiancé. Despite their long-standing engagement, her fiancé broke it off after Shui Dao repeatedly embarrassed him in public. Abandoned and ridiculed, Shui Dao felt despair. However, she gathered her strength, rejected any notion of reconciliation, and decided to take control of her destiny. She resolved to find a new partner, noticing many eligible bachelors in her village. Her choice fell upon the enigmatic 'Third Uncle,' a man known as an 'old bachelor' who had been single his entire life. Her family was dismayed, believing she had made a terrible mistake. Yet, the man she chose proved to be surprisingly kind and caring, defying his initial reputation. Follow Shui Dao's journey as she navigates love and family expectations in a new era, proving that sometimes, the best choices are the most unexpected.
